Take advice again, tell your solicitor:
There was an agreement (oral contract?) to replace the car.
The repair they are suggesting has already been attempted and it failed.
The dealer needs to be given a deadline to resolve the complaint.
Get advice on the timescales that govern what actions you can take.

There is a difference between you "rejecting" the car and the dealer or SEAT "replacing" the car. And different criteria and timescales apply.

On Monday you will have owned the car for 9 days and the timescale will be critical for some actions. Get professional advice from a solicitor or trading standards on what options are available to you. Don't take advice from the dealer on what you can and can't do.

If your only option is to let them repair the gearbox you need to find that out for certain now!
